Maxx AX5 Plus vs Xolo A500s IPS
Here you can compare Maxx AX5 Plus and Xolo A500s IPS. Comparing Maxx AX5 Plus vs Xolo A500s IPS on Smartprix enables you to check their respective specs scores and unique features. It would potentially help you understand how Maxx AX5 Plus stands against Xolo A500s IPS and which one should you buy The current lowest price found for Maxx AX5 Plus is ₹6,325 and for Xolo A500s IPS is ₹3,999. The details of both of these products were last updated on Apr 25, 2024.
Specification | Maxx AX5 Plus | Xolo A500s IPS |
---|---|---|
Battery | 1800 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 1400 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
Display | 4.5 inches, 480 x 854 pixels | 4 inches, 480 x 800 pixels |
Rear Camera | 5 MP | 5 MP |
OS | Android v4.0.4 (ICS) | Android v4.2 (Jelly Bean) |
Internal Memory | 512 MB | 4 GB |
Price | ₹6,325 | ₹3,999 |
